Basel won 3:1 against FC Zürich after being down 0:1 at first. Alex Frei, who started as Basel's captain today, scored the equalizer with a beautiful free kick. Great way to end his amazing career that began in Basel 16 years ago and now ended in Basel, too.

GL Jinx strikes again: Olympiacos gets their equalizer under contentious circumstances after a scramble in the box - Pana felt that the goal was offside but it was razor close

The Panathinaikos players proceeded to attack the ref like I have never seen...I think at one point the ref was pushed to the ground beneath an avalanche of 8 or 9 pana players and some subs

The goal was scored at 87....89 now and Pana still arguing - big crowd of 20 or so people near the benches surrounding the ref
